Appropriate Attire for Relaxation
For the majority of daytime hours, particularly by the pool or within the spa areas, the dress code leans toward relaxed sophistication. Think elegant resort wear: luxurious cotton or linen shirts for men, and breathable linens or silks for women. Tailored shorts, flowing midi skirts, and well-fitted casual dresses are all acceptable, provided they maintain a polished look. Athletic wear is generally reserved for the gym or pool deck, ensuring that relaxation zones maintain a refined atmosphere.

- Men: Polo shirts, casual button-downs, tailored shorts, and light trousers.
- Women: Sundresses, rompers, tailored pants, and chic tops.
- Footwear: Flip-flops are acceptable by the pool; sandals or casual shoes for exploring the resort grounds.

Specific Guidelines for Fine Dining
When sitting down to a multi-course meal under the stars, guests are encouraged to embrace a more formal aesthetic. For men, this means swapping the polo for a collared shirt—perhaps a subtle button-down or a stylish casual shirt—paired with tailored trousers or well-kept jeans. A belt and refined shoes complete the look. Women have the flexibility to choose between a sophisticated dress, a tasteful jumpsuit, or a coordinated skirt and top set, ideally complemented by statement jewelry or an elegant wrap.
| Occasion | Recommended Attire |
|---|---|
| Pool/Daytime Relaxation | Resort wear, casual linen, comfortable sandals |
| Fine Dining | Collared shirts/tailored trousers for men; dresses/elegant separates for women |
| Spa Access | Complimentary robes provided, comfortable pre-and-post-treatment clothing |
Weather and Practical Considerations
The climate of Paradise Valley demands practicality alongside style. Light, breathable fabrics are non-negotiable for comfort, making natural fibers the de facto choice for any itinerary item. While the dress code permits a range of looks, it implicitly discourages overly heavy or synthetic materials that do not align with the desert climate. Furthermore, guests should be prepared for sunny conditions; a wide-brimmed hat or stylish sun hat is not just practical but aligns perfectly with the resort's aesthetic of sun-kissed elegance.
